#4c73da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c73da is composed of 29.8% red, 45.1%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 223.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#4c73da color hex could be obtained by blending #98e6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4c73da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4c73da has RGB values of R:76, G:115,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5010394.

Hex triplet 4c73da #4c73da
RGB Decimal 76, 115, 218 rgb(76,115,218)
RGB Percent 29.8, 45.1, 85.5 rgb(29.8%,45.1%,85.5%)
CMYK 65, 47, 0, 15
HSL 223.5°, 65.7, 57.6 hsl(223.5,65.7%,57.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 223.5°, 65.1, 85.5
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 50.521, 19.161, -56.946
XYZ 21.763, 18.859, 68.819
xyY 0.199, 0.172, 18.859
CIE-LCH 50.521, 60.083, 288.597
CIE-LUV 50.521, -18.07, -89.488
Hunter-Lab 43.426, 13.46, -63.56
Binary 01001100, 01110011, 11011010

Shades and Tints of #4c73da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030710 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4c73da is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#737373 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6b7388 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#477cdd Protanopia 1% of men
  • #0081d7 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#008b95 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4978dc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1b7cd8 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1b82ae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
